1. The Power of AI-Backed Advertising Campaigns for Real Estate
AI-backed advertising campaigns are changing the landscape of real estate marketing by allowing real estate professionals to precisely target their audience, automate much of the lead generation process, and deliver personalized ads at scale.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Google Ads offer a perfect foundation for these AI-driven campaigns. Here’s how to leverage them effectively:
a. Facebook and Instagram Ads
- AI-Powered Targeting: Facebook and Instagram have incredibly advanced audience segmentation capabilities, allowing you to target users based on demographic data, behaviors, interests, and past engagement. AI can be used to analyze user data and adjust ad targeting automatically, ensuring that your real estate ads are seen by the most relevant potential buyers and sellers.
- Custom Audiences and Lookalike Audiences: By utilizing AI, you can create custom audiences from existing lead data (e.g., website visitors, engagement with past ads) and develop lookalike audiences that mirror the characteristics of your highest-converting leads. This ensures that your campaigns consistently attract the right people.
- Dynamic Ads for Real Estate Listings: Facebook allows the creation of dynamic ads that automatically show personalized listings to users based on their browsing activity on your website. With AI, these ads can be fine-tuned in real-time to increase engagement by adjusting images, messaging, and offers depending on the viewer’s preferences.
b. Google Ads for Real Estate
- AI-Driven Search Ads: Google Ads can be particularly effective for buyers who are actively searching for properties. With AI, search campaigns can be optimized to focus on specific keywords relevant to your target audience (e.g., “luxury homes in Miami” or “investment properties in Los Angeles”). AI algorithms will automatically bid on the most relevant search terms based on historical performance, optimizing for conversions rather than clicks.
- Smart Display Ads: Google’s AI-powered display ads use machine learning to find potential buyers and sellers across millions of websites. These ads can automatically adjust based on which images and messaging have the highest likelihood of driving a conversion, such as scheduling a property tour or requesting more information.
- Google Ads Retargeting: AI can also help retarget website visitors who have shown interest in your listings, ensuring they continue to see relevant property ads across various online platforms. This keeps potential leads engaged and improves the chances of conversion.
2. Directing Leads to WhatsApp for Instant Communication
Once potential leads engage with your ads on Facebook, Instagram, or Google, directing them to WhatsApp offers a direct and personal way to communicate with them. WhatsApp, with its wide user base and ease of use, is a powerful tool for real estate teams, allowing for real-time conversations, quick responses, and nurturing relationships. Here’s how you can integrate WhatsApp into your marketing funnel:
- Seamless WhatsApp Integration: AI-powered advertising campaigns can be linked directly to a WhatsApp business account, allowing potential buyers to initiate a conversation with your real estate sales team instantly. This instant communication fosters trust and keeps the prospect engaged from the start.
- Chatbots for Initial Engagement: AI chatbots can be implemented on WhatsApp to handle initial inquiries, provide basic information about properties, schedule appointments, and answer FAQs. This automation ensures no lead is missed, even during off-hours, and keeps the potential buyer engaged until a sales agent can take over.
- Personalized Follow-Up: Once the lead is connected to WhatsApp, sales teams can use AI-driven CRM systems to personalize follow-up messages, ensuring every communication is tailored to the individual’s needs, preferences, and behaviors.
- WhatsApp Group for Ongoing Engagement: You can create a WhatsApp group with a potential buyer and their family members or real estate professionals, such as agents or attorneys. This creates a collaborative environment, keeps conversations open, and fosters transparency throughout the buying process.
3. Using Video Funnels to Nurture and Convert Leads
Video content is one of the most powerful tools for converting real estate leads. When integrated into a funnel, it allows potential buyers to be guided through the decision-making process with visuals that bring properties to life. Video funnels, enhanced with AI, can be automated to present the right content at the right time, nurturing leads toward conversion.
a. Why Video Funnels Work
- Visual Storytelling: Real estate is inherently visual, and video allows you to showcase properties in a way that static images cannot. Video tours, 3D walkthroughs, and aerial footage can give potential buyers a clear idea of the property’s layout and unique features, increasing their likelihood of scheduling a visit or making an offer.
- Emotional Connection: Videos create an emotional connection by allowing prospects to picture themselves living in a home. Well-produced videos can convey the lifestyle associated with the property, helping buyers make an emotional decision.
b. AI-Driven Video Funnel Strategy
- Personalized Video Content: AI algorithms can be used to personalize the video experience for each prospect based on their preferences and previous interactions. For example, if a lead has shown interest in luxury properties, the video funnel will automatically show high-end listings in their preferred areas.
- Video Retargeting Campaigns: By using AI to track video interactions, you can retarget potential buyers who have watched a property video but have not yet taken action (such as scheduling a viewing). Personalized follow-up videos can be shown to these leads on platforms like YouTube or social media, moving them further down the funnel.
- Automated Video Emails: Send personalized video emails to leads that are triggered based on their actions, such as filling out a contact form or interacting with a property listing. AI can automatically generate tailored content, highlighting similar listings or providing more in-depth information about properties they’ve shown interest in.
4. AI-Powered Sales Systems to Maximize Closures
Once the lead is captured through AI-driven advertising campaigns, WhatsApp, and video funnels, the next step is to convert them into sales. AI-powered sales systems can be employed to streamline the closing process and maximize conversions.
a. Lead Scoring and Qualification
- AI-Based Lead Scoring: Not all leads are created equal, and AI-powered sales systems can automatically score and qualify leads based on their likelihood to convert. By analyzing past behavior, engagement level, and property preferences, AI can prioritize high-quality leads for immediate follow-up by your sales team.
- Behavioral Triggers: AI can detect when a lead is most likely to convert by analyzing their online behavior, such as how many times they’ve interacted with a property listing, watched a video, or asked for information. These behavioral triggers can alert your sales team to take immediate action, increasing the chance of a successful close.
b. Automated Follow-Ups
- AI-Driven CRM Systems: Integrating AI into your CRM allows for automated follow-ups with leads via email, WhatsApp, or SMS. These follow-ups can be customized based on the lead’s stage in the funnel and personalized with the properties or information they’re most interested in.
- Predictive Analytics for Closing Deals: AI systems can use predictive analytics to forecast the likelihood of closing a deal and recommend the next best actions for the sales team. For example, AI might suggest offering a virtual tour or providing financial information if it detects the lead is close to making a decision.
c. Video-Assisted Sales Closures
- Live Virtual Tours: Use video conferencing tools integrated with your AI systems to conduct live virtual tours with prospective buyers, allowing them to view multiple properties from the comfort of their home. This can significantly speed up the buying process for remote or international buyers.
- Video Q&A Sessions: After viewing property videos, prospects may have questions or concerns. Hosting live video Q&A sessions where they can directly interact with a sales agent or property expert can help overcome objections and move them closer to closing.
